Defining the Combined Hormonal Contraceptive
Lilia is an oral pharmaceutical preparation classified as a Combined Hormonal Contraceptive (CHC), falling under the pharmacological class of synthetic steroidal agents. Its fundamental purpose is the prevention of pregnancy in women of childbearing potential. This prescription-only medication is exclusively designed for oral administration and is presented as a circular film-coated tablet.
As an oral contraceptive, Lilia is a combination product, utilizing the actions of two distinct active ingredients. Composition and Type: Chlormadinone Acetate and Ethinyl Estradiol
The composition of Lilia is defined by its two active ingredients: the synthetic estrogen Ethinyl Estradiol and the synthetic progestogen Chlormadinone acetate. This combination of synthetic, steroidal hormones forms the basis of the drug's composition. The medication is a monophasic combined oral contraceptive, meaning the quantity of both hormones remains uniform across all active tablets within the treatment cycle.
Combined pills rely on suppressing ovulation and altering the cervical environment to prevent fertilization. The consistent delivery of these two hormones works to maintain a stable level of contraceptive effectiveness throughout the cycle.
The Unique Properties of Chlormadinone Acetate
Chlormadinone acetate is a progesterone derivative that is pharmacologically distinguished by its intrinsic antiandrogenic properties. This specific characteristic means that the active ingredient not only contributes to the core contraceptive mechanism but also opposes the effects of androgens (male hormones) within the body. This antiandrogenic capability is a key identifying element of the Lilia formulation, providing a pharmacological distinction from other types of combined pills.
